2014 • GIULIO RASPERINI and TIZIANO TESTORI • BIOTYPE PROBE

Soft tissue texture, contour, color and thickness play a key role in dental esthetic. The most commonly used technique to classify the biotype is the clinical judgment by the operator. But this technique is user sensitive and therefore delivers inconsistent results. Rasperini and Testori designed the first instrument to assess biotype in a reliable and reproducible manner that was also non-invasive. The clinical advantage of this instrument can be applied to different fields of dentistry. In Periodontology, one knows when to add a

connective tissue graft to a Coronally Advanced Flap in periodontal plastic surgery in case of gingival recession. In Restorative dentistry, it provides information on the tissue and where we are able to hide margins of the restoration. In orthodontics, it can indicate the risks to predispose or induce gingival recession during orthodontic treatment to aid in prevention. For Implantology, according to the biotype, the choice to add or not add the connective tissue graft can be made in order to create esthetic and stable soft tissue contour. Using this instrument in Professional Hygiene allows one to select the best curette dimension to prevent soft tissue shrinkage and the right type of brushing tool.
